Delving into the World of Project Management Certifications: PMP vs. PRINCE2

Embarking on a journey to enhance your project management prowess? You'll often discover two prominent certifications: the Project Management Professional (PMP) and PRINCE2. Selecting the right certification can be challenging, as each system offers distinct merits. The PMP, a globally recognized credential by the Project Management Institute (PMI), focuses on a comprehensive suite of project management knowledge areas aligned around the PMBOK Guide. On the other hand, PRINCE2, developed in the United Kingdom, emphasizes a rigorous process for managing projects within organizations.

  • The PMP is ideal for experts seeking a versatile credential adaptable to diverse industries and project types.
  • PRINCE2 stands out in environments where strict governance and oversight are paramount, often found in larger organizations or government sectors.

Ultimately, the best choice depends on your aspirations, industry, and organizational culture. Thoroughly examining both certifications can help you make an informed decision that aligns with your professional growth.
